🌶️ Hunan Bar | Pittsburgh's Unassuming Sichuan Treasure

Tucked away in a modest Squirrel Hill storefront, Hunan Bar is a legendary, no-frills, and utterly addictive destination for authentic, boldly spiced Chinese cuisine. This is not a fancy restaurant; it's a beloved, cash-only, family-run institution that has been quietly serving some of the most electrifying Sichuan and Hunan flavors in Pittsburgh for decades, drawing loyal crowds who know exactly why they keep coming back. ✨ The Hunan Bar Experience: The atmosphere is wonderfully unpretentious—think simple tables, handwritten specials on the wall, and the intoxicating aroma of chili oil, Sichuan peppercorns, and sizzling wok hei—creating a setting where the food is unquestionably the star. The menu is a treasure trove of numbing, spicy, deeply flavorful classics: the Dry-Fried Eggplant is caramelized, tender, and perfectly balanced; the Mapo Tofu delivers that signature má là (numbing-spicy) punch; the Twice-Cooked Pork is smoky and savory; and the Cumin Lamb is fragrant, bold, and utterly addictive. Don't miss the Dumplings in Chili Oil—they're legendary for good reason. The service is efficient and no-nonsense.
